CM Vishnu Dev Sai paid floral tributes to legendary freedom fighter Barrister Madhusudan Das on the occasion of Utkal Divas at Mahila Thana Chowk (Madhusudan Das Chowk) in Raipur today.
Chief Minister extends best wishes to Utkal Samaj and people of Odisha
CM Vishnu Dev Sai extended warm greetings and best wishes to all the brethren of the Utkal Samaj in the State and across the country on the occasion of Odisha Statehood Day (Utkal Divas). He said that this day is not just a celebration of the formation of Odisha, but an inspiration of struggle, self-pride and cultural unity. The Chief Minister said that a large number of people of Utkal Samaj live in Chhattisgarh, which strengthens the social harmony and diversity of the state.
Salutes the contribution of Barrister Madhusudan Das
CM Vishnu Dev Sai said that it was due to the struggles of a visionary and dedicated personality like Barrister Madhusudan Das that the State of Odisha was formed on 1st April 1936. The Chief Minister said that Chhattisgarh and Odisha have had cultural and social ties for centuries. He said that the rice offered to Lord Jagannath still comes from Chhattisgarh. Especially the rice of the Devbhog region, which is used as the Lord’s prasad, symbolizes the religious connect of the two states.
